Edit: Disregard the picture make info on the right....it is incorrect. It seems that even after a bajillion layers in photoshop, the computer still recognizes information from the photos that were originally taken. (In this case, I believe it was =defabe-stock's photo that put the info into this, because it was the first picture I used in the layers and I expanded the canvas from there.)
